The reduction potential of an oxidation reaction in a half-cell is denoted by the symbol E°.
Reduction potential is the tendency of a given chemical species to become reduced, that is, gain electrons or undergo a decrease in oxidation number. The greater the reduction potential, the more likely that a species will be reduced.
